Electro-acupuncturing at “Baihui”point and “Zusanli”point on beha-vior and mRNA expression of intestinal NK1 receptor in rats with irrita-ble bowel syndrome

Abstract

Objective To observe the effects of electro-acupuncturing (EA)at “Baihui”(DU20)and“Zusanli”(ST36)on the visceral sensitivity and emotional and psychological behavior of the irritable bowel syndrome (IBS)model rats,and to explore the double adjustment of electro-acupuncture on chron-ic visceral pain with emotional and psychological dysfunction.Methods Wistar immature rats were ran-domly divided into normal group,model group and electro-acupuncture group.The IBS model was in-duced by mechanical colorectal irritation of acetic acid combined with maternal separation in the postnatal period.Rats of normal group and model group underwent no intervention while those of electro-acupunc-ture group were needled at “Baihui”and “Zusanli”every other day for ten days.The visceral sensitivity was evaluated and the open-filed test was used,and the mRNA of neurokinin-1(NK1)receptor was de-tected by using RT-PCR.Results The treatment of acupuncture reduced significanty the visceral sensi-tivity,crossing activity and vertical activity in open field test,and the mRNA expression of NK1.Con-clusion The double adjustment of electro-acupuncturing at “Baihui”and “Zusanli”on chornic visceral sensitivity with emotional and psychological dysfunction was proved.
